1. A method of generating a pulsed beam of laser light of long duration from a flashlamp-excited laser, comprising:

  • generating a ramp pulse having an amplitude which generally increases with time during substantially the entire duration of a pulsed beam of laser light produced by a flashlamp-excited laser, anddriving the flashlamp-excited laser with the ramp pulse.
